Museums & Historical Monuments<br />

Kenya not only offers a natural beauty but is also<br />

rich in history and culture. Those tourists curious<br />

about the people and past of the country can<br />

explore the various museums and monuments on<br />

offer.<br />

Nairobi National Museum<br />

The Nairobi National Museum houses celebrated<br />

collections of Kenyan history, culture and art.<br />

In addition to the educational value offered at the<br />

museum, visitors can relax in the botanical<br />

gardens and take a walk to the snake park<br />

available in the area. Visiting the Museum is a<br />

fantastic afternoon activity for those looking to<br />

relax.<br />

An important historical landmark in the East African<br />

region and a national treasure, Fort Jesus in located<br />

in Mombasa. It was built to secure<br />

the safety of Portuguese living on the East Coast of<br />

Africa. The fort was used as a barrack for the<br />

soldiers and converted to a prison when the British<br />

colonized the area. Today it is a museum visited by<br />

historically curious tourists from all over the world.<br />
